Bangalore: One word that is in the headlines these days is a bulldozer. In UP action is being taken by using bulldozers in the houses and shops of the miscreants in many states including Madhya Pradesh and Gujarat. Now the incident has reached Karnataka. In fact, former Karnataka CM Kumaraswamy has attacked the BJP. He said the BJP will make Karnataka Uttar Pradesh, Madhya Pradesh and Gujarat.

 

Former CM Kumaraswamy attacked the BJP, saying that now in Karnataka also, the BJP is demanding bulldozing culture. Don't make Karnataka Uttar Pradesh, Madhya Pradesh or Gujarat. Kumaraswamy said that a minister of the government is saying that bulldozers have come to Delhi, and he wants to bring them to Karnataka. The former chief minister said the crisis does not end here. 

 

If anyone set up a small shop to meet daily needs, that is illegal. Meaning the government doesn't have the capacity to give you land for shops. Let us know that BJP's national general secretary CT Ravi had said that there was a time when terrorists were fed biryani. Biryani is no longer fed now. Now even if someone moves the tail, the JCB bulldozer will reach. He had said that the Uttar Pradesh model should be followed in Karnataka.
